What will you be doing in this role?

The Administrative Intern will be responsible for assisting Executive staff with planning support for business plans, program development and evaluation, strategic plans and environmental assessment projects. The intern demonstrates behavior that supports the Cedars-Sinai Health System mission. They attend required orientation, training, and project meetings. They meet production standards within the established time requirements and ensure work products and performance meet quality standards.

Additionally, the intern demonstrates respect and positive interpersonal skills with patients, clients, the public, managers and co-workers. They also maintain confidentiality of patient care and business matters.

Finally, they protect the safety of others and of the physical plant and equipment, following institutional policies, fire safety and infection control requirements.

Primary Duties and Responsibilities:

  • Collaborates with stakeholders to define scope of assignment, goals, and deliverables.
  • Communicate with team members and stakeholders to facilitate assignment progress, ensuring key deliverables and milestones are met.
  • Conducts research and assists with the retrieval and identification of data analyses in support of business development decisions and/or operations projects.
  • Assists with the preparation of general environmental assessment documents and analyses.
  • Assists with the preparation of market assessments including competitor analysis and preparation of demand forecasts.
  • Assists in the analysis and evaluation of operational programs and identify opportunities for performance improvement.
  • Conducts secondary research such as internet searches, gathering of competitive intelligence, etc.
  • Assists the Manager of Administrative Services and other administrative/executive staff with other special projects and functions related to operations.

Cedars-Sinai

Since its beginning in 1902, Cedars-Sinai has evolved to meet the healthcare needs of one of the most diverse regions in the nation, continually setting new standards for quality and innovation in patient care, research, teaching and community service. Today, Cedars-Sinai is widely known for its national leadership in transforming healthcare for the benefit of patients. Cedars-Sinai receives consistent recognition for our excellence. Our awards include; being named one of America’s Best Hospitals by U.S. News & World Report, receiving the National Research Corporation’s Consumer Choice Award 19 years in a row for providing the highest-quality medical care in Los Angeles, achieving the longest-running Magnet designation for nursing excellence in California, and being recognized as The Advisory Board Company’s 2017 Workplace of the Year, an award Cedars-Sinai has won three years in a row. This annual award recognizes hospitals and health systems nationwide that have outstanding levels of employee engagement. Cedars-Sinai is a leader in the clinical care and research of heart disease, cancer and brain disorders, among other areas. Pioneering research achievements include using cardiac stem cells to repair damaged hearts, developing minimally invasive surgical techniques and discovering new types of drugs to target cancer more precisely. Cedars-Sinai also impacts the future of healthcare through education programs that encompass everything from highly competitive medical residency and fellowship programs to a biomedical science and translational medicine PhD program, advanced training for nurses and educational opportunities for allied health professionals.
